The main problem I am having now is running the power cable / RCA cables / remote wire into the trunk. This car's trunk is basically a shell with no holes in it. So I was thinking of drilling in my rear rack. I did find a hole behind a bunch of carpet and panelling... it looks like it's for the signal cables/brake lights. I was thinking feeding the cables through the same path as the signal light cable using a coat hanger, but it seems like a tight fit. Plus I still have to pry open a side panel inside the car just to get at that passageway. Drilling seems like the easiest way.
